Imparare Python facilmente

Cerca nel sito

Altri risultati..

Generic selectors
Exact matches only
Search in title
Search in content
Post Type Selectors
Linguaggio Python


Indice

Python

Il Linguaggio Python. 

Python è un linguaggio di programmazione caratterizzato da semplicità sintattica, chiarezza,e, contemporaneamente, grande potenza, flessibilità e scalabilità. Python ha una vasto utilizzo nei più diversi scopi: pagine dinamiche, applicazioni eseguibili, web scraping, analisi dei dati. Lavora con molta efficienza con diverse tipologie di database e si integra ad altri linguaggi e framework. Sempre più professionisti del web si avvicinano a questo elegante linguaggio di programmazione sempre più richiesto nel mondo del lavoro.

Questo Corso ti avvicinerà con facilità alla struttura tipica di Python ed a scoprirne la potenzialità in associazione con il suo web framework più conosciuto e utilizzato: Django. 


Vantaggi di Python

• Python è un linguaggio Turing-complete
• Che è un modo elegante di dire che ci si può eseguire qualsiasi computazione (algoritmo)
• Ha la stessa «potenza» di altri linguaggi (ad es., Java, C++, PHP), ma è più semplice, più chiaro e più conciso
• Python è facilmente estensibile con dei package/moduli aggiuntivi che possono essere «importati»
• Esiste una grande quantità di moduli che coprono le più disparate funzionalità
Il repository ufficiale PyPI conta 206192 progetti al 23 novembre 2019
• Secondo stackoverflow.com, «Python is the second most used programming language [after JavaScript]  and it is the fastest-growing major programming language today».

  • E’ disponibile per tutti i sistemi operativi.
  • E’ uno dei linguaggi più utilizzati per quanto riguarda il Data Mining ed il Machine Learning.

Linguaggi compilati vs linguaggi interpretati

I linguaggi possono essere categorizzati in diverse maniere. Una delle distinzioni principali è quella tra linguaggi compilati e linguaggi interpretati.

Linguaggio interpretato vs compilato

Python è interpretato?

• Python non effettua una vera compilazione in linguaggio macchina
• Non viene creato direttamente un file eseguibile
• Il sorgente viene passato all’interprete che lo compila in un bytecode (come Java e C#), il quale poi viene interpretato in linguaggio macchina per essere eseguito
• E’ possibile interagire con l’interprete scrivendo python nella riga di comando e premendo invio
• L’avvio della modalità interattiva è segnalato da >>>

Installazione di Python

Dal sito Python.org

nella sezione download scaricare la versione corrente:

 

 

 

 

 

(209)


Ti potrebbe interessare anche:  Python: Basi di programmazione ad oggetti